草庐IT

XSS_CLEAN

全部标签

ios - iPhone 应用程序测试 : How do I get a clean install?

在测试我正在开发的iPhone应用程序时,我可以采取某些步骤来引发错误,例如,即使我要终止应用程序并加载它,也会导致应用程序在加载时崩溃或在其他某个时间点持续崩溃再次起来。我假设,为了重置导致崩溃的内部状态不稳定,我可以简单地重新安装应用程序。但是,重新安装后问题仍然存在,只能通过安装更新​​的版本来解决。我只能假设一些应用数据被保留和重复使用,即使它被删除并重新安装(从IPA)。有没有办法避免这种情况发生?例如。进行某种“全新安装”?编辑:如果我重新安装并重启我的手机,那么问题就解决了。这是否特别指出应用代码存在任何问题? 最佳答案

objective-c - iOS - 从 Objective-C 中的媒体获取 [Explicit] 和 [Clean] 标签

当我在iTunes中查看我购买的音乐时,歌曲列表中的歌曲旁边会显示一个红色的露骨框。IE。您在购买歌曲时看到的显式标签会传递到iTunes资料库。对于标记为干净的itunes歌曲也是如此。我真的很想能够识别我的ios应用程序中明确的任何歌曲,但我找不到任何关于标签是否与其他歌曲信息(MPMediaItemProperty)一起传递到ios设备的资源,如果是,如何传递得到它(我无休止地搜索!)有些歌曲在标题末尾包含“[Explicit],但这只是某些歌曲的情况,而不是全部。有谁知道标签是否存在并且可以从Objective读取-C代码? 最佳答案

swift - Clean swift 如何将数据传回 viewController

classListBillPaymentFavoriteRouter:NSObject,ListBillPaymentFavoriteRoutingLogic,ListBillPaymentFavoriteDataPassing{weakvarviewController:ListBillPaymentFavoriteViewController?vardataStore:ListBillPaymentFavoriteDataStore?//MARK:RoutingfuncrouteToBillPaymentInput(){letdestinationVC=BillPaymentInp

swift - 替代 swift build --clean?

所以过去是在命令行中,swiftbuild--clean会通过删除.build目录来清理构建。您也可以通过--clean=dist来删除包。我刚刚升级到Swift4,这些显然都没有了。它是否已被卷入子命令或其他内容?任何人都可以指出我的一些文档吗?我找不到他们...实际上,我根本找不到有关子命令的文档。我知道引入了swiftrun和swiftpackage。任何人都知道这些命令和其他命令的完整文档在哪里?我在各个地方找到了零碎的描述,但还没有找到完整的文档(希望存在于某处) 最佳答案 swiftbuild--clean已在swift

swift - 为什么 XCode Clean and Build 会修复 EXC_BAD_ACCESS?

我见过很多人(包括我)因未知原因面临EXC_BAD_ACCESS崩溃。许多解决方案的答案cleanandbuildtheproject标记为正确。我很好奇为什么会发生这种情况以及清理和重建如何修复它,但似乎人们并不关心并继续使用清理构建解决方案。这是一个example这些EXC_BAD_ACCESS具有干净构建的解决方案。就我而言,我面临着这样荒谬的事情:funcviewDidLoad(){super.viewDidLoad()self.childVC.delegate=self//=>CrashedEXC_BAD_ACCESShere.Fixedaftercleanandbuild}

android - android studio中clean项目和rebuild项目的区别

CleanProject和RebuildProject(在AndroidStudio中)有什么区别?我的R文件关于resids有问题,因此我将文件扩展名从gif到png然后[我的构建失败。]我发现解决方案是重建项目。这提示了我上面的问题。 最佳答案 清理只是删除所有构建Artifact。重建会进行清理,然后再构建您的项目。编辑#2这是100%正确的。引用this以彻底证明其正确性。 关于android-androidstudio中clean项目和rebuild项目的区别,我们在Stack

android - android studio中clean项目和rebuild项目的区别

CleanProject和RebuildProject(在AndroidStudio中)有什么区别?我的R文件关于resids有问题,因此我将文件扩展名从gif到png然后[我的构建失败。]我发现解决方案是重建项目。这提示了我上面的问题。 最佳答案 清理只是删除所有构建Artifact。重建会进行清理,然后再构建您的项目。编辑#2这是100%正确的。引用this以彻底证明其正确性。 关于android-androidstudio中clean项目和rebuild项目的区别,我们在Stack

java - Java Web应用程序中防止SQL注入(inject)攻击和XSS的方法

我正在编写一个java类,它将由servlet过滤器调用,并检查注入(inject)攻击尝试和基于Struts的javaweb应用程序的XSS。InjectionAttackChecker类使用正则表达式和java.util.regex.Pattern类根据正则表达式中指定的模式验证输入。话虽如此,我有以下问题:应阻止所有特殊字符和字符模式(例如、.、--、=)以防止注入(inject)攻击。是否有我可以按原样使用的现有正则表达式模式?在某些特定情况下我必须允许一些特殊字符模式,一些示例值(允许)是(使用'pipe'|字符作为不同值的分隔符)*Atlanta|#654,BLDG8#50

java - 像这样在构造函数中调用init方法是否违反了Clean Code

我在下面的代码中担心的是构造函数的参数实际上并没有直接映射到类的实例字段。实例字段从参数派生值,我正在为其使用initalize方法。此外,我做了一些事情,以便可以在下面的代码中直接使用创建的对象,例如调用drawBoundaries()。我觉得它正在做抽象意义上创建(初始化)Canvas的意思。我的构造函数是不是做得太多了?如果我添加方法以从外部显式调用构造函数中的内容,那将是错误的。请让我知道您的看法。publicclassCanvas{privateintnumberOfRows;privateintnumberOfColumns;privatefinalListlistOfCe

java - 如何清理 HTML 代码以防止 Java 或 JSP 中的 XSS 攻击?

我正在编写一个基于servlet的应用程序,我需要在其中提供一个消息传递系统。我赶时间,所以我选择CKEditor提供编辑功能,我目前将生成的html直接插入显示所有消息的网页中(消息存储在MySQL数据库中,仅供引用)。CKEditor已经基于白名单过滤HTML,但是用户仍然可以通过POST请求注入(inject)恶意代码,所以这还不够。已经存在一个很好的库来通过过滤HTML标记来防止XSS攻击,但它是用PHP编写的:HTMLPurifier那么,是否有类似的成熟库可以用在Java中?基于白名单的简单字符串替换似乎还不够,因为我也想过滤格式错误的标签(这可能会改变显示消息的页面的设计